Introduction: Virtue Construction is more affordable than many companies because many general contractors sub out a majority of the work they are hired to complete. The subcontractor and general contractor both have to make profit on the completed job and there are more hands involved in the final product, creating more risk at times for things to go wrong. Because of our many years in the industry, Virtue Construction is able to complete many building projects in house; this includes painting, drywall, tile, roofing, siding, and more. This reduces the cost and the risk, and increases the quality, customer service, and ease of renovation/building. The first time we hired Jason was to replace a 40 year old tin roof that had skylights in it. He was was quick and very through.There were rotten beams, dead bird nests, broken vent pipes that were filling the house with stink when the heater came on and and he, instead of just doing the job he was hired for, took the time to address the problems and fixed them. He really knows his business and made us aware of any issues or potential issues. We were very pleased with his integrity and skill.The roof is beautiful, he even gave us pointers on color for trim.Now we need to freshen up the outside of the house to match our beautiful roof. We have hired Jason and his wife ( the design part) again to remodel a bathroom in a very old trailer house. As he tor into the floor he found LOTS of rot and previous cobbled together handwork of DIY;ers.Pipes were just hanging in the walls with out bracing etc. it just went on.There were all kind of setbacks with the trailer because of the lack of maintenance and lack of knowledge of DYI'rs that created more problems, pretty much a domino effect of impending trouble. Jason had a good attitude and was very helpful in offering options,even when I was ready to sell it for scrap.The bathroom is great April has a great eye for color and design and Jason is very knowledgeable, honest and through. Another thing I want to mention is that when Jason noticed the tin coming off an old out building in a wind storm and fixed it on his own, no charge. You just never hear of that kind of thing anymore.It is a pleasure hiring him, I know i wont be taken advantage of and have the piece of mind that the work is sound. I HIGHLY recommend them they are honest !
